§ 38.350. Core Principle 6.

The board of trade, in consultation or cooperation with the Commission, shall adopt rules to provide for the exercise of emergency authority, as is necessary and appropriate, including the authority:
(a)To liquidate or transfer open positions in any contract;
(b)To suspend or curtail trading in any contract; and
(c)To require market participants in any contract to meet special margin requirements.
